TIP: How To Make a Small Exhibition Booth Stand Out
1. Use lighting – spotlight certain products/ brand names.
2. Develop a theme for your booth – think colours, entertainment, giveaways.
3. Put signage above the sightline – make it easy for delegates to navigate to your stand.
4. Display the product or name most recognised by delegates – this will get their attention and draw them in.
5. Interact with the delegates – we’re talking full service, not self-service!

TIP: Exhibition Do’s and Don’ts
DO – Be strategic about what sponsors you allow to exhibit at your events (think quality not quantity)
DO - Be creative in the design of your exhibition space (think custom scents, massage zones, gelato stations and various entertainment)
DO - Consider your exhibitors’ objectives, products and services and tailor your sponsorship packages accordingly
DON’T – Overcrowd your exhibition space, clean and simple is the key!
